任务一 下拉式菜单设计弹出式流程图
任务目标任务一 下拉式菜单设计弹出式流程图 掌握下拉菜单的绘制及组态
第一步:确定标准按钮大小、位置及翻页功能,完成下拉式菜单窗口设计任务一 下拉式菜单设计弹出式流程图在【图形对象的大小和位置】调整栏中调整“标准按钮”图元的尺寸及位置。属性分别设置如下:“运行界面”按钮:左顶点坐标(0,0)、图形对象大小110×40像素;“混合界面”按钮:左顶点坐标(0,40)、图形对象大小110×40像素;“灌装界面”按钮:左顶点坐标(0,80)、图形对象大小110×40像素。分别在【操作属性】页面勾选相应的运行界面、混合界面、灌装界面等用户窗口。
第二步:确定下拉式菜单位置,完成下拉式菜单功能组态任务一 下拉式菜单设计弹出式流程图复制公共窗口中的标准按钮“流程图”按钮,并在“运行界面”用户窗口中,覆盖原标准按钮“流程图”按钮,并完成如下操作。步骤1:在【基本属性】中,修改标准按钮“流程图”按钮的背景色,使之与其他按钮有明显的颜色区别。步骤2:在【操作属性】中,不进行任何设置。
第二步:确定下拉式菜单位置,完成下拉式菜单功能组态任务一 下拉式菜单设计弹出式流程图复制公共窗口中的标准按钮“流程图”按钮,并在“运行界面”用户窗口中,覆盖原标准按钮“流程图”按钮,并完成如下操作。步骤3:在【脚本程序】中,完成以下脚本。在“抬起脚本”页面,单击“打开脚本程序编辑器”,输入以下脚本:!OpenSubWnd(流程图下拉菜单,111,120,110,80,18)
第二步:确定下拉式菜单位置,完成下拉式菜单功能组态任务一 下拉式菜单设计弹出式流程图脚本程序编辑器使用方法:
第二步:确定下拉式菜单位置,完成下拉式菜单功能组态任务一 下拉式菜单设计弹出式流程图脚本程序的运算符运算符符号说明运算符符号说明算术运算符^乘方比较运算符?大于*乘法=大于等于/除法=等于\整除=小于等于+加法?小于-减法?不等于Mod取模运算逻辑运算符AND逻辑与???NOT逻辑非???OR逻辑或???XOR逻辑异或
第二步:确定下拉式菜单位置,完成下拉式菜单功能组态任务一 下拉式菜单设计弹出式流程图下拉式菜单设计中使用的!OpenSubWnd()系统函数为例进行介绍显示子窗口!OpenSubWnd()函数格式为:!OpenSubWnd(参数1,参数2,参数3,参数4,参数5,参数6)在“运行按钮”中调用“流程图下拉式菜单”用户窗口,其脚本程序为:!OpenSubWnd(运行界面下拉菜单,111,120,110,120,18)其参数6的数值为18,即转换成二进制为2#0010010。
第二步:确定下拉式菜单位置,完成下拉式菜单功能组态任务一 下拉式菜单设计弹出式流程图!OpenSubWnd(参数1,参数2,参数3,参数4,参数5,参数6)参数1:要打开的子窗口名称。此例中子窗口,即用户窗口,名称为:流程图下拉菜单。参数2:整型,打开子窗口相对于本窗口的X坐标。如在用户窗口“运行界面”中,单击标准按钮“运行按钮”,则本窗口为用户窗口“运行界面”、子窗口为用户窗口“流程图下拉菜单”,即“流程图下拉菜单”窗口相对于“运行界面”窗口的X坐标。参数3:整型,打开子窗口相对于本窗口的Y坐标。即“流程图下拉菜单”窗口相对于“运行界面”窗口的Y坐标。参数4:整型,打开子窗口的宽度。即“流程图下拉菜单”窗口在“运行界面”窗口显示的宽度大小。参数5:整型,打开子窗口的高度。即“流程图拉菜单”窗口在“运行界面”窗口显示的高度大小。参数6:整型,打开子窗口的类型。
第二步:确定下拉式菜单位置,完成下拉式菜单功能组态任务一 下拉式菜单设计弹出式流程图!OpenSubWnd(参数1,参数2,参数3,参数4,参数5,参数6)参数6各位功能说明:二进制位数功能说明举例说明第0位是否模式打开0,不使用模式打开功能;1,使用模式打开功能,必须在此窗口中使用“!CloseSubWnd(子窗口名)”来关闭本子窗口。第1位是否菜单模式0,不使用菜单模式。1,使用菜单模式,在子窗口之外点击,则子窗口关闭。第2位是否显示水平滚动条0,不显示水平滚动条;1,显示水平滚动条。第3位是否显示垂直滚动条0,不显示垂直滚动条;1,显示垂直滚动条第4位是否显示边框0,不显示边框;1,显示边框,在子窗口周围显示细黑线边框。第5位是否自动跟踪显示子窗口0,不自动跟踪显示子窗口;1,自动跟踪显示子窗口,在当前点击位置上显示子窗口。第6位是否自动调整子窗口的宽度和高度为缺省值0,不自动调整子窗口的宽度和高度为缺省值;1,自动调整子窗口的宽度和高度为缺省值,忽略iWidth和iHeight的值。
谢谢观看!
您可能关注的文档
- 智能家居设备安装与调试 教案全套 人大 项目一 智能家居认知 任务一:智能家居职业感知---7.2 三居室智能家居的设计安装与调试.docx
- MCGS触摸屏工程项目实践应用 课件 任务一 配方组态设计.pptx
- 智能家居设备安装与调试 课件 任务二 混合界面流程图绘制——对象元件库的使用.pptx
- 智能家居设备安装与调试 课件 任务二 触摸屏组态工程设计流程.pptx
- MCGS触摸屏工程项目实践应用 课件 任务一 认识MCGS触摸屏硬件与组态软件.pptx
- MCGS触摸屏工程项目实践应用 课件 任务四 IO测试画面组态.pptx
- 智能家居设备安装与调试 课件 任务三 工程下载及通讯状态测试.pptx
- MCGS触摸屏工程项目实践应用 课件 任务一 触摸屏通信原理.pptx
- MCGS触摸屏工程项目实践应用 课件 任务二 触摸屏供电电源接线.pptx
- MCGS触摸屏工程项目实践应用 课件 任务三 简单流程图组态设计.pptx
- 小区绿化施工协议书.docx
- 墙面施工协议书.docx
- 1 古诗二首(课件)--2025-2026学年统编版语文二年级下册.pptx
- (2026春新版)部编版八年级道德与法治下册《3.1《公民基本权利》PPT课件.pptx
- (2026春新版)部编版八年级道德与法治下册《4.3《依法履行义务》PPT课件.pptx
- (2026春新版)部编版八年级道德与法治下册《6.2《按劳分配为主体、多种分配方式并存》PPT课件.pptx
- (2026春新版)部编版八年级道德与法治下册《6.1《公有制为主体、多种所有制经济共同发展》PPT课件.pptx
- 初三教学管理交流发言稿.docx
- 小学生课外阅读总结.docx
- 餐饮门店夜经济运营的社会责任报告(夜间贡献)撰写流程试题库及答案.doc
原创力文档

文档评论(0)